Face & Body Foundation
The go-to face and body foundation for House of Dior runway shows, Dior Backstage Face & Body Foundation offers luminous results and a custom coverage effect, from the most natural glow to a high-perfection complexion. It immediately evens out and smooths the complexion, and blurs imperfections for a weightless, second-skin finish.
Imperceptible and comfortable, the ultra-fine texture of this liquid foundation blends seamlessly with the skin upon application for long-lasting wear that withstands extreme conditions: sports, contact with water, high temperatures and damp environments.
Composed of 94%* natural-origin ingredients, the clean** formula of the foundation is infused with plant-derived squalane and hyaluronic acid. Non-comedogenic, Dior Backstage Face & Body Foundation hydrates the skin all day long.
* Amount calculated based on the ISO 16128-1 and ISO 16128-2 standard. Water percentage included. The remaining ingredients contribute to the formula’s performance, sensory appeal and stability.
